1. How to Tell the Difference Between Imagination and Spirit
One of the biggest questions people ask is: “How do I know if it’s my imagination or my guide?”
Here’s the key: trace the source of the thought.
If the idea follows a logical chain of thinking — A to B to C — it’s likely your mind. But if the thought drops in out of nowhere — like A to B to Q — that’s often your guide.
Spirit messages feel like sudden clarity, not mental noise. They’re subtle, calm, and infused with love — never fear or urgency.
Ask yourself:
-
Did this thought come from nowhere?
-
Does it feel gentle, loving, or supportive?
-
Did it leave me feeling more guided or at peace?
If so, trust it.
Your imagination tries to create. Spirit tries to communicate.
2. How to Hear Your Guides More Clearly
Most people think connecting with their guides means trying harder — but it’s the opposite. It’s about getting quieter.
Our ego minds are loud. They narrate, judge, and analyze constantly. I call mine Frankie Brain. Once you name it, you can spot it — and learn to quiet it.
Spirit doesn’t shout. Spirit speaks in silence.
Here’s a simple practice you can try:
-
Sit comfortably and take a few deep breaths.
-
Place your hands on your heart.
-
Say silently or aloud:
“Spirit guides of the highest love and light, I invite you to step into my energy and let me know you’re with me.” -
Then simply allow. Don’t try. Don’t expect. Just be.
You might feel warmth, tingling, a shift in the air, or even goosebumps — each sign is unique. The more you relax and allow, the clearer their energy becomes.
3. Why It Sometimes Feels Like Your Guides Aren’t Answering
If you’ve ever thought, “My guides aren’t talking to me,” know this: they are. You just might not be able to receive it yet.
Spirit communicates through energy, and your vibration determines how clearly you can hear.
When you’re anxious, angry, or sad, your energy contracts — like a small, narrow doorway that blocks the signal. But when you raise your vibration through love, calm, and kindness, that doorway widens, and the guidance flows freely.
That’s why connection begins within. When you focus on love — especially self-love — you raise your energy and open the space for your guides to step in.
Remember: you don’t have to earn their attention. They already love you. Your only job is to soften, trust, and surrender.
